Cesar Zarate is a dedicated music educator, accomplished performer, and brass specialist based in Sacramento, California. He holds both a Bachelor's degree in Music Education and a Master's degree in Teaching from California State University, Sacramento. During his studies, Cesar had the privilege of working with esteemed mentors including Jennie Blomster (Horn), William R. Shannon, Monica Martinez, and Elisha Wells, among others.

 

Cesar teaches Band, Orchestra, and Choir at Wilson C. Riles Middle School in Roseville, CA, where he strives to inspire a lifelong appreciation for music in his students. He is also a proud member of the artistic staff of the Sacramento Youth Symphony, serving as a brass coach. In addition to his teaching roles, Cesar has served as a clinician for French Horn at the CBDA Northern California Super Saturday All-State Clinics since 2023.

​​

An accomplished performer, Cesar has played horn with prestigious ensembles such as the Sacramento State Wind Ensemble, Symphony Orchestra, and the Sacramento Youth Symphony Orchestra. As a versatile brass specialist, he is proficient in playing trumpet, horn, trombone, euphonium, and tuba, bringing a wealth of knowledge and expertise to his instruction.

 

Cesar has been an integral part of Hayward La Honda Music Camp since 2017, where he initially served as a lead counselor and now contributes as the Camp Counselor Coordinator. His commitment to fostering young talent extends to his private teaching studio in Sacramento County.

 

With his dedication to music education, performance, and mentorship, Cesar Zarate is proud to contribute to the vibrant musical landscape of the Sacramento region.
